A Deep Dive into the History of the Missouri Tigers
The Missouri Tigers, representing the University of Missouri, have a rich and storied history that dates back to the university's founding in 1839. The athletic programs officially began in the late 19th century, with the football team playing its first game in 1890. Over the decades, the Tigers have become a prominent fixture in collegiate sports, particularly within the Southeastern Conference (SEC). The university's colors, old gold and black, were adopted early on and have since become synonymous with the spirit and pride of the institution. The establishment of iconic venues like Faurot Field and the Hearnes Center further cemented the Tigers' presence in the collegiate sports arena. These facilities have not only hosted countless memorable games but have also become symbols of the university's commitment to athletic achievement. The integration of women's sports programs in the latter half of the 20th century added another dimension to the Tigers' athletic legacy, fostering greater inclusivity and expanding opportunities for female athletes. Top Sports Programs at Mizzou
When we talk about the Missouri Tigers, we've got to highlight some of their top sports programs! These teams consistently bring the heat and keep fans on the edge of their seats. First off, there's football. Mizzou football has a long and proud history, with numerous bowl appearances and conference titles. The atmosphere at Faurot Field on game day is electric, creating an unforgettable experience for players and fans alike. The team's rivalries, especially the Border War with Kansas, add extra intensity to the season, fueling passionate competition. Next up is basketball. The men's basketball team has seen its share of success, making NCAA Tournament appearances and producing NBA talent. Games at Mizzou Arena are always lively, with the Antlers student section bringing the noise and creating a tough environment for opponents. The women's basketball team is also a force to be reckoned with, consistently competing for conference championships and earning national recognition. Let's not forget about baseball either! Mizzou baseball has a strong tradition, with multiple College World Series appearances. Taylor Stadium is a great place to catch a game, especially on a warm spring evening. The team's success is built on a foundation of solid pitching, timely hitting, and aggressive base running.
